Human-computer interaction, often abbreviated as HCI, defines the study and planning of how people use computers and technology. At its core, an HCI example illustrates the relationship between a user and a device, software, or website. These examples range from the simple act of clicking a mouse to the complex gestures used on a modern smartphone. Understanding these interactions helps designers create products that feel intuitive rather than frustrating. Every time a person successfully logs into an account or adjusts the thermostat with a voice command, they are experiencing a successful HCI example.
The Core Disciplines of Interaction Design
HCI is not a single field; it is a multidisciplinary practice that blends psychology, engineering, and design. When looking at an HCI example, you often see the influence of cognitive science in how users process information. Ergonomics plays a role in physical devices like keyboards and VR headsets to prevent strain. Usability testing is the practical method used to validate whether an HCI example actually works for real people. This blend of science and art ensures that technology serves human needs rather than the other way around.
Visual Design and Layout
Visual design is the most visible part of an HCI example, dictating how users perceive the interface. Colors, typography, and spacing guide the eye and indicate importance. A well-designed interface reduces the user's cognitive load, making tasks feel effortless. For instance, a banking app uses color to differentiate between money going out and coming in. This visual feedback is a critical component of any effective HCI example.
Understanding User-Centered Workflows
User-centered design is the philosophy that drives modern HCI, focusing on the needs, limitations, and goals of the end-user. An HCI example is not judged by its technical complexity, but by its efficiency in solving a human problem. This often involves creating user personas and journey maps to anticipate behavior. By analyzing these workflows, designers can identify pain points and refine the interaction flow. The goal is to make the user feel in control, not confused.
The Role of Feedback Loops
Feedback is the response system within an HCI example that informs the user their action was successful. Without feedback, a user might repeatedly click a button, thinking it is broken. This can be auditory, like a "click" sound, or visual, like a button changing color. In a complex system, feedback loops provide status updates during waiting times. Effective feedback closes the loop of interaction, reassuring the user that the system is working.
Advanced Technologies in Modern HCI
As technology evolves, the scope of HCI expands beyond screens and keyboards. Gesture recognition, voice assistants, and augmented reality create new HCI examples that mimic natural human communication. These technologies require designers to think in three dimensions and consider spatial audio. The challenge lies in making these advanced interactions feel natural and predictable. Studying these new models provides insight into the future direction of digital interaction.
Accessibility as a Priority
A truly successful HCI example is accessible to the widest range of users, including those with disabilities. This means considering color contrast for the visually impaired or providing keyboard shortcuts for those who cannot use a mouse. Accessibility is not an afterthought; it is a core requirement of ethical design. When developers incorporate these standards, the HCI example becomes more robust and universally usable. This inclusive approach benefits every user, regardless of their abilities.
Measuring Success and Iteration
Determining the quality of an HCI example relies on data and observation. Metrics such as task completion time, error rates, and user satisfaction scores provide concrete evidence of performance. Heatmaps and session recordings offer a visual HCI example of exactly how users navigate a page. This data drives iteration, allowing teams to refine the interface based on real behavior. Continuous improvement ensures that the interaction remains effective and relevant over time.